The fund was officially announced in 1983 and was named the Social Solidarity Fund, which is the first charitable fund in Bahrain, based on a license issued by the Ministry of Labor and Social Affairs under book No. Ann / 41 / 1983, under the umbrella of the Sanabis Club, but with an independent administration from the club.

 Over the past twenty-four years, the Fund has contributed to many charitable and social activities for the people of the region, until this fund has now become a social institution that adopts programs and work projects of an advanced nature and character that reflects the horizons and ambitions of its founders.

 And in cooperation with religious, cultural and social institutions in the region.

• In October 1962, the Sanabis Charitable Fund started working until 1982 (without official announcement).
• From 1983 until 1993, he worked in the name of the Social Solidarity Fund (official declaration).
• In 1994, the name of the Social Solidarity Fund was changed to the Sanabis Charitable Fund when charitable funds spread in the Kingdom of Bahrain. Therefore, the Sanabis Charitable Fund is considered the first charitable fund established in Bahrain.

In 2010, the name of the Sanabis Charitable Fund was changed to the Sanabis Charitable Society. It was published in the Official Gazette on December 2, 2010.
